Peep's Project


Calling all creative “Peep”-le !

It’s that time again to start brainstorming for some creative ideas for the annual peeps project contest. You know the drill ! Create a clever diorama using the beloving Easter marshmallows as feature characters. To recap last year’s first place winners include “in peepsana beach”(teen category), “sonic the peepshog”(kids category), and “Vladimir peepin goes home to visit his mother”(adult category). Let those sugar coated chicks and rabbits tell a compelling story. Something profound. Something humorous. Something relatable. The possibilities are endless. To enter the contest, bring your finished project to the Whiting-Robertsdale chamber of commerce by March 24th where they will on display for the passersby to admire. Don’t forget to title your project and give the Chamber your name, age, and the contact information. Voting for the peeps project will be Monday March 27 and will close on Saturday April 1st. A winner will be selected from three category’s : adults (18+), teens(13-17) and kids (12- under).
